Baby Name Origin and Meaning

Kaii is a name of Hawaiian origin meaning "sea" or "ocean." It reflects the beauty and power of the ocean, often symbolizing vastness, mystery, and serenity. Individuals named Kaii are believed to possess qualities associated with water, such as fluidity, adaptability, and depth of emotions.

Gender: Male

Origin: Hawaii

Syllables: 2

Pronunciation: The name Kaii is pronounced "KYE-ee"
